"Story about a women working at a hospital and is asked to clean the Morgue"
"It was mid September, I had just gotten told that I was given the unpleasant job of cleaning the Morgue at the local Hospital.
Now I have done this before. In fact i was no stranger to doing it, and it never really bothered me. But this time it did mainly because it was after two in the morning, and I was tired, I had worked a 7 and a half hour shift already and they told me I can go home after I cleaned it.
So I walked down towards the elevator and hit the "M" button. A few minutes went by and the elevator doors opened. I stepped out and almost immediately the atmosphere changed it was especially dark and eerie this night.
I turned on the light and began to get my cleaning supplies from the closet. I had left the room for a second to get a sponge. I came back the light was off. I figured it must have been due to faulty wiring down here or at least that is what I told myself to feel better,I didn't dare think about all the people who were put to rest in this room. I was told a head of time that most of the freezers had humans in them so just to Mop the floor. So I began to
Mop the floor when I heard a strange noise coming from one of the freezer doors, I looked in the direction of the Noise. I slowly opened the freezer door and called out "Hello?" I heard nothing this time but silence. I grabbed the freezer door and closed it. After a few minutes went by, I heard the noise again. This time I walked over to the same freezer and called out "Hello?" No response.
I was scared but continued to mop. Just then the phone rang. I jumped up out of my skin. I answered the phone, it was One of the many doctors we had at the hospital. he said "we have made a terrible mistake there is a young women in Freezer "7D"who we said was dead but Now we believe she was just in a coma. Check it out for us please." I told the doctor to stay on the line. As I slowly went to the fridge and opened it, It was the same freezer that I heard the noises earlier.
I opened the freezer door all the way out a women was lying there on the stretcher starring up at me. The woman then sat up straight at me, and let out one of the most terrifying screams I have ever heard in my life.
She had long blonde hair and she had on a pair of jeans, and she was wearing a tank top. I jumped back Giving her some space and
Most importantly me some space. She jumped to her feet she said "Which way is it to the nearest exit?" "I told her to take the elevator up to the 1st floor". She said "thanks" and ran as fast as she could out of the Morgue, I fainted.
